基於pic24FJ64GA306 OBD方式的轎車多功能定速巡航系統方案

 

隨著汽車的普及,人們對於汽車的認識從乘坐,運載逐漸向著安全,舒適,節油轉變。人們對於汽車外觀以及汽車的安全配置,舒適配置的要求越來越高。定速巡航系統主要是把駕駛人員的右腳解放出來,開過車的人都知道在高速上狂奔時候,右腳總是要踩在油門上的,讓車保持一定的速度前進,在經過長途駕駛後駕駛員會覺得右腿酸麻,不舒服。而且人力去控制油門力度範圍總是偏大,造成行駛中的汽車忽快忽慢。對於油耗的消耗也偏大,因為汽車在等速行駛狀態下相對油耗是比較低的。工信部的油耗資料在90公里/小時等速行駛下測得的。

定速巡航系統可以讓駕駛員在駕駛中按照所需要的行駛速度進行設定,設定後定速巡航系統會自動讓車按照設定速度行駛。自行調整汽車在行進過程中的速度差,由於系統調整速度很快,乘坐車感覺不出系統對於車速的調整過程在2012年前生產的車型只有在中高端配置的車型上才會有定速巡航功能,對於低配的大多數車輛來說,沒有配備定速巡航功能。

基於pic24FJ64GA306的OBD介面的定速巡航方案,利用原車的OBD介面都去定速巡航所需要的控制參數,通過PIC24FJ64GA306的高速運算,對汽車的行動機構進行控制, 達到一個閉環的恒速控制效果,從而完成定速功能

►場景應用圖

►產品實體圖

►展示板照片

►方案方塊圖

►核心技術優勢

基於pic24FJ64GA306的OBD定速巡航系統利用原車OBD信號,通過Canbus或者K-line來讀取汽車行駛中的速度信號,油門開度信號等參數,STM32F103內部集成了汽車IEE1939的協定,通過該協定可以解析出車速,油門等信號,通過串口把參數傳遞給pic24FJ64GA306. 當駕駛員設定定速巡航的行駛速度時候,pic24Fj64GA306會通過演算法把定速的速度數值與行駛中從OBD讀取的數值進行對比,通過演算法對行駛速度進行調整,保證汽車按照設定的速度進行等速運行,達到解放駕駛員右腳以及降低油耗的目的

►方案規格

①從OBD介面通過Canbus K-line讀取參數 ②使用arm晶片對IEE1939協定進行解析 ③系統從OBD取電12V ④系統整體運行電流小於100mA ⑤系統運算採用了XLP的Microchip的高性能16bitMCU

技術文檔

類型標題檔案
硬件BOM
硬件Data Sheet_1
硬件Data Sheet_2
操作手冊User Manual